Transaction 99d3eda6958848c75b7746ffafff324d1d822f9ba3fd140383c36dae1aefb66e

1 Input
2 Outputs
  • 99d3eda6958848c75b7746ffafff324d1d822f9ba3fd140383c36dae1aefb66e:0
  • value  20000
    address  15qvBdqSWQCuLQPXVoWViG2GvjeARmpYPw
  • 99d3eda6958848c75b7746ffafff324d1d822f9ba3fd140383c36dae1aefb66e:1
  • value  5756886
    address  1EXdFFQXyn3PuLFx7dpog9whGNuqXfdaR8